#include "meminfo.h"
#include <QDebug>
#include <errno.h>
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<sys/stat.h>
#include <unistd.h>
/* Parse the contents of /proc/meminfo (in buf), return value of "name"
* (example: MemTotal)
* Returns -errno if the entry cannot be found. */
static long long get_entry(const char *name, const char *buf)
{
const char *hit = strstr(buf, name);
if (hit == NULL) {
return -ENODATA;
}
errno = 0;
const long long val = strtoll(hit + strlen(name), NULL, 10);
if (errno != 0) {
int strtoll_errno = errno;
perror("get_entry: strtol() failed");
return -strtoll_errno;
}
return val;
}
/* Like get_entry(), but exit if the value cannot be found */
static long long get_entry_fatal(const char *name, const char *buf)
{
const long long val = get_entry(name, buf);
if (val < 0) {
qFatal("could not find entry '%s' in /proc/meminfo: %s", name, strerror((int)-val));
}
return val;
}
/* If the kernel does not provide MemAvailable (introduced in Linux 3.14),
* approximate it using other data we can get */
static long long available_guesstimate(const char *buf)
{
long long Cached = get_entry_fatal("Cached:", buf);
long long MemFree = get_entry_fatal("MemFree:", buf);
long long Buffers = get_entry_fatal("Buffers:", buf);
long long Shmem = get_entry_fatal("Shmem:", buf);
return MemFree + Cached + Buffers - Shmem;
}
MemInfo readMemInfo()
{
// Note that we do not need to close static FDs that we ensure to
// `fopen()` maximally once.
static FILE *fd;
// On Linux 5.3, "wc -c /proc/meminfo" counts 1391 bytes.
// 8192 should be enough for the foreseeable future.
char buf[8192] = {0};
MemInfo m = {0, 0, 0};
if (fd == NULL)
fd = fopen("/proc/meminfo", "r");
if (fd == NULL) {
qFatal("could not open /proc/meminfo: %s", strerror(errno));
}
rewind(fd);
size_t len = fread(buf, 1, sizeof(buf) - 1, fd);
if (ferror(fd)) {
qFatal("could not read /proc/meminfo: %s", strerror(errno));
}
if (len == 0) {
qFatal("could not read /proc/meminfo: 0 bytes returned");
}
m.memTotalKiB = get_entry_fatal("MemTotal:", buf);
long long MemAvailable = get_entry("MemAvailable:", buf);
if (MemAvailable < 0) {
// kernel was too old
MemAvailable = available_guesstimate(buf);
}
// Calculate percentages
m.memAvailablePercent = (double)MemAvailable * 100 / (double)m.memTotalKiB;
// Convert kiB to MiB
m.memAvailableMiB = MemAvailable / 1024;
return m;
}
